diff options
author | Nathan Fritz <nathan@andyet.net> | 2010-11-16 17:58:20 -0800 |
---|---|---|
committer | Nathan Fritz <nathan@andyet.net> | 2010-11-16 17:58:20 -0800 |
commit | 45991e47eeab97f0411139c5b1627ac6350de3d0 (patch) | |
tree | 4491e8eeef90129b53b3a49abade19134e36b617 | |
parent | b8f40eb8431dd0965d6ed3fd61956f4c91729202 (diff) | |
download | slixmpp-1.0-Beta4.tar.gz slixmpp-1.0-Beta4.tar.bz2 slixmpp-1.0-Beta4.tar.xz slixmpp-1.0-Beta4.zip |
scheduler no longer waits for the next event before exitingsleek-1.0-Beta41.0-Beta4
-rw-r--r-- | sleekxmpp/xmlstream/scheduler.py |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/sleekxmpp/xmlstream/scheduler.py b/sleekxmpp/xmlstream/scheduler.py index e0324cbe..14359102 100644 --- a/sleekxmpp/xmlstream/scheduler.py +++ b/sleekxmpp/xmlstream/scheduler.py @@ -149,6 +149,8 @@ class Scheduler(object): if wait <= 0.0: newtask = self.addq.get(False) else: + if wait >= 3.0: + wait = 3.0 newtask = self.addq.get(True, wait) except queue.Empty: cleanup = [] |